Anaelkremer

Anaël Kremer contributed to the Inist-CNRS/lodex repository by building and refining data export, filtering, and presentation features over six months. He standardized CSV/TSV export workflows, improved data governance, and enhanced maintainability through configuration management and internationalization. Using JavaScript and React, Anaël optimized filtering algorithms for more accurate and efficient data retrieval, while also addressing data integrity and UI clarity in both loader and network visualization components. His work included updating documentation to streamline onboarding and removing obsolete files, resulting in a cleaner codebase. These efforts collectively improved reliability, security, and usability for both end users and developers.

September 2025 performance summary for Inist-CNRS/lodex: Delivered targeted improvements to the export pipeline, focusing on CSV/TSV export customization and terminology alignment. Implemented dynamic configuration to select resource fields for export and excluded internal fields ('chart' and 'home') from full exports. Updated translations.tsv to align with export formats and terminology. These changes improve data accuracy, governance, interoperability with external systems, and reduce risk of exposing internal data.

August 2025 monthly summary for Inist-CNRS/lodex. Focused on delivering reliable export workflows, improving data governance, and enhancing maintainability through standardization across export modules. Key features delivered: - Export: Standardized file naming and labeling for CSV/TSV exports; ensured correct extensions (.csv, .tsv) and harmonized exporter labels across translations/config (commits 55b60f8e65f82155c8eb2999c94ed1d99ee3adfa, 61d6724867b940280b6fe2095ae0a30dc298603e). Major bugs fixed: - Export: Fixed hidden fields exclusion in TSV export; exchange output now omits hidden fields to prevent leakage (commit 74ba808d6d1c62260d93f150d10871befa9cd1d0).
